Career Path
Environmental Consultants: Advise businesses on reducing environmental impact and complying with regulations. High demand in urban planning and corporate sustainability sectors.
Sustainability Managers: Lead initiatives to improve energy efficiency and reduce carbon footprints. Key roles in manufacturing, retail, and public sectors.
Land Management Specialists: Oversee land use, conservation, and development projects. Essential in agriculture, forestry, and real estate industries.
Policy Advisors in Sustainability: Develop and implement policies to promote sustainable practices. Critical in government and non-profit organizations.
Renewable Energy Project Managers: Manage projects focused on solar, wind, and other renewable energy sources. Growing demand in the energy sector.
